Technical Features of Overhead Cranes

Overhead cranes come equipped with various technical features that enhance their functionality and safety. Below is a comparison table highlighting some of the key technical features:

Feature Description Importance
Load Capacity The maximum weight the crane can lift, typically ranging from a few tons to hundreds of tons. Determines the crane’s suitability for specific tasks.
Span The distance between the crane’s support structures. Affects the area of coverage and operational efficiency.
Lift Height The maximum height the crane can lift loads. Critical for operations in high warehouses or manufacturing plants.
Speed The speed at which the crane can move loads horizontally and vertically. Influences productivity and efficiency in operations.
Control System Can be manual, semi-automatic, or fully automatic. Enhances user safety and operational efficiency.
Safety Features Includes overload protection, emergency stop buttons, and limit switches. Essential for preventing accidents and ensuring safe operation.
Power Source Can be electric, hydraulic, or pneumatic. Determines the crane’s operational flexibility and efficiency.

Types of Overhead Cranes

Overhead cranes are categorized based on their design and application. Here’s a comparison table of the different types of overhead cranes:

Type Description Applications
Bridge Crane Consists of a horizontal beam supported by two end trucks. Used in manufacturing and assembly operations.
Gantry Crane Similar to a bridge crane but supported by legs that move on the ground. Ideal for outdoor applications and shipyards.
Jib Crane Features a horizontal arm (jib) that pivots on a vertical post. Used for localized lifting in workshops.
Monorail Crane A single rail system that allows for horizontal movement. Common in assembly lines and warehouses.
Portable Crane Lightweight and easy to move, often used for small tasks. Suitable for construction sites and small workshops.
Overhead Hoist A simpler version of an overhead crane, primarily for lifting. Used in smaller operations and maintenance tasks.

FAQs

1. What is the primary function of an overhead crane?
Overhead cranes are designed to lift and move heavy loads across a workspace, improving efficiency and safety in material handling.

2. How do I determine the right load capacity for my overhead crane?
Consider the maximum weight of the loads you will be lifting and choose a crane with a load capacity that exceeds this weight for safety.

3. What safety features should I look for in an overhead crane?
Look for features such as overload protection, emergency stop buttons, limit switches, and safety interlocks to ensure safe operation.

4. Can overhead cranes be used outdoors?
Yes, gantry cranes are specifically designed for outdoor use, while other types can also be used outdoors if properly equipped and maintained.

5. How often should overhead cranes be inspected?
Regular inspections should be conducted according to manufacturer guidelines and local regulations, typically at least once a year, to ensure safety and compliance.
